Liam Rosenior wants Argentine international as his first Chelsea signing

What are the type of signings will Rosenior want to see Chelsea make? Well, it looks like he has his eyes set on a familiar face from his time at Strasbourg.

As reported by DSports, Rosenior will target Valentin Barco as a possible reinforcement. He wants one of his key players at Strasbourg as his first signing for Chelsea.

Barco is a full Argentine international. The 21-year-old was a regular starter for Rosenior at Strasbourg.

Barco made his name as a left-back while breaking into senior football at Boca Juniors. But at Strasbourg, he played mostly in the middle of the park. If Chelsea do sign him, it is probably there that Rosenior will deploy him.
